Rogers County commissioners voted to transfer county-owned property in the Summerlin Industrial Park in the Anola area to the Rogers County Industrial Development Authority to facilitate economic development.

Commissioners discussed that a business seeking to expand in the park requires a development partner better positioned to handle industrial transactions. A county commissioner said the transfer would make it easier “to conduct that business,” and the board voted to approve the conveyance.

Commissioner Peck seconded the motion and Commissioner Burrows voted aye; the motion carried.

The transfer had been tabled at the Oct. 27, 2025 meeting for further review. The board did not provide additional details in the record about the parcel’s legal description, sale price, or any conditions attached to the transfer.
